From b2bfba69223d0a2772a95da89bf322edb0559ba3 Mon Sep 17 00:00:00 2001 From: Bjorn Terelius Date: Mon, 5 Mar 2018 20:52:04 +0100 Subject: [PATCH] Declare the RtpHeaderExtensionMap* as const in RtpHeaderParser::Parse. M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Bug: None Change-Id: I38ba9f879dfd5b46f2209f107d20c41529fb645c Reviewed-on: https://webrtc-review.googlesource.com/59801 Reviewed-by: Danil Chapovalov Commit-Queue: Björn Terelius Cr-Commit-Position: refs/heads/master@{#22299} --- modules/rtp_rtcp/source/rtp_utility.cc | 5 +++-- modules/rtp_rtcp/source/rtp_utility.h | 2 +-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/modules/rtp_rtcp/source/rtp_utility.cc b/modules/rtp_rtcp/source/rtp_utility.cc index c814716b44..6e62250cfb 100644 --- a/modules/rtp_rtcp/source/rtp_utility.cc +++ b/modules/rtp_rtcp/source/rtp_utility.cc @@ -159,8 +159,9 @@ bool RtpHeaderParser::ParseRtcp(RTPHeader* header) const { return true; } -bool RtpHeaderParser::Parse(RTPHeader* header, - RtpHeaderExtensionMap* ptrExtensionMap) const { +bool RtpHeaderParser::Parse( + RTPHeader* header, + const RtpHeaderExtensionMap* ptrExtensionMap) const { const ptrdiff_t length = _ptrRTPDataEnd - _ptrRTPDataBegin; if (length < kRtpMinParseLength) { return false; diff --git a/modules/rtp_rtcp/source/rtp_utility.h b/modules/rtp_rtcp/source/rtp_utility.h index b71b9dca16..14684df4e3 100644 --- a/modules/rtp_rtcp/source/rtp_utility.h +++ b/modules/rtp_rtcp/source/rtp_utility.h @@ -51,7 +51,7 @@ class RtpHeaderParser { bool RTCP() const; bool ParseRtcp(RTPHeader* header) const; bool Parse(RTPHeader* parsedPacket, - RtpHeaderExtensionMap* ptrExtensionMap = nullptr) const; + const RtpHeaderExtensionMap* ptrExtensionMap = nullptr) const; private: void ParseOneByteExtensionHeader(RTPHeader* parsedPacket,